Instituto de Córdoba seeks this Tuesday to ratify its good moment in the League Cup when it receives Rosario Central on the tenth round, in a match in which both need to add to advance in the fight to get into the next phase. The match will begin at 9:30 p.m., the main referee will be Ariel Penel, Germán Delfino will be on the VAR and it will be televised on the ESPN Premium signal. Those led by Diego Dabove enjoy a great present, and although the objective was to consolidate themselves in the category, the good results make them excited about advancing to the quarterfinals, the same objective that the Rosario team pursues, although they also keep intact the chances of achieve a pass to the next Copa Sudamericana. The Alta Córdoba team has gone six games without defeats, comes from a very good 3-1 victory as a visitor against Huracán, and has 14 points, occupying third place in zone A, behind Independiente (18) and River (17) , while the "scoundrel" has accumulated three games without losses and with 12 units is expectant, after equaling with Vélez (1-1) last date. Dabove will have all his players to be able to repeat the formation that defeated "Globo", while Miguel Ángel Russo will not have Agustín Sández in his ranks, who suffered a blow against Vélez, although there would be no variations in the initial formation, since that the former Boca had entered the complement. In the highest category, Córdoba and Rosario faced each other 25 times, with Rosario Central dominating, which won nine against Institute's two, while they tied in the remaining 14 games.
